Franziska Bezold is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Spectroscopy and Filtration and Separation. According to data from OpenAlex, Franziska Bezold has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 366 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Materials Chemistry, 5 papers in Spectroscopy and 5 papers in Filtration and Separation. Recurrent topics in Franziska Bezold’s work include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(5 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Chromatography (5 papers) and Crystallization and Solubility Studies (5 papers). Franziska Bezold is often cited by papers focused on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(5 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Chromatography (5 papers) and Crystallization and Solubility Studies (5 papers). Franziska Bezold collaborates with scholars based in Germany. Franziska Bezold's co-authors include Mirjana Minceva, Maria E. Weinberger, Heiko Briesen, J. Goll, Michael Kühn and Sandra Lang and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Chromatography A, Journal of Food Engineering and Molecular Physics.
